INFO: Using directory: "1" INFO: Regenerating c-file: Airport_scannerII.c CFLAGS= -DLOADPATH=@MCCODE_LIB@/data ----------------------------------------------------------- Generating single GPU kernel or single CPU section layout: ----------------------------------------------------------- Generating GPU/CPU -DFUNNEL layout: ----------------------------------------------------------- INFO: Recompiling: ./Airport_scannerII.out "./Airport_scannerII.c", line 4104: warning: variable "randstate" was declared but never referenced unsigned long randstate[7]; ^ "./Airport_scannerII.c", line 4023: warning: variable "newlen" was declared but never referenced long newlen = 0; ^ "./Airport_scannerII.c", line 5725: warning: variable "ret" was declared but never referenced int ret=1,stat=0,plane_stat=0; ^ "./Airport_scannerII.c", line 5898: warning: variable "D" was declared but never referenced double A,B,C,D,k; ^ "./Airport_scannerII.c", line 9012: warning: variable "tc2" was declared but never referenced Coords tc1, tc2; ^ "./Airport_scannerII.c", line 9013: warning: variable "tr1" was declared but never referenced Rotation tr1; ^ "./Airport_scannerII.c", line 9459: warning: variable "status" was set but never used int status=0; ^ "./Airport_scannerII.c", line 9529: warning: variable "i" was declared but never referenced int i,j; ^ "./Airport_scannerII.c", line 9529: warning: variable "j" was declared but never referenced int i,j; ^ "./Airport_scannerII.c", line 9530: warning: variable "p1" was declared but never referenced double *p1,*p2,*p3; ^ "./Airport_scannerII.c", line 9530: warning: variable "p2" was declared but never referenced double *p1,*p2,*p3; ^ "./Airport_scannerII.c", line 9530: warning: variable "p3" was declared but never referenced double *p1,*p2,*p3; ^ "./Airport_scannerII.c", line 9585: warning: variable "i" was declared but never referenced int i; ^ "./Airport_scannerII.c", line 10061: warning: variable "k" was declared but never referenced int i,j,k; ^ "./Airport_scannerII.c", line 10062: warning: variable "e" was declared but never referenced double e,p2; ^ "./Airport_scannerII.c", line 10220: warning: variable "alpha" was declared but never referenced double alpha,e,k,kx_vac,ky_vac,kz_vac,mu,mu0,delta,beta,f; ^ "./Airport_scannerII.c", line 10220: warning: variable "mu" was declared but never referenced double alpha,e,k,kx_vac,ky_vac,kz_vac,mu,mu0,delta,beta,f; ^ "./Airport_scannerII.c", line 10220: warning: variable "delta" was declared but never referenced double alpha,e,k,kx_vac,ky_vac,kz_vac,mu,mu0,delta,beta,f; ^ "./Airport_scannerII.c", line 10220: warning: variable "beta" was declared but never referenced double alpha,e,k,kx_vac,ky_vac,kz_vac,mu,mu0,delta,beta,f; ^ "./Airport_scannerII.c", line 10220: warning: variable "f" was declared but never referenced double alpha,e,k,kx_vac,ky_vac,kz_vac,mu,mu0,delta,beta,f; ^ "./Airport_scannerII.c", line 10221: warning: variable "nx" was declared but never referenced double l0,l1,nx,ny,nz; ^ "./Airport_scannerII.c", line 10221: warning: variable "ny" was declared but never referenced double l0,l1,nx,ny,nz; ^ "./Airport_scannerII.c", line 10221: warning: variable "nz" was declared but never referenced double l0,l1,nx,ny,nz; ^ "./Airport_scannerII.c", line 10223: warning: variable "m" was declared but never referenced int i=1,j,m,status=0,exit=0; ^ "./Airport_scannerII.c", line 10223: warning: variable "exit" was declared but never referenced int i=1,j,m,status=0,exit=0; ^ "./Airport_scannerII.c", line 10224: warning: variable "intersect" was declared but never referenced int intersect=0,entry_exit=0; ^ "./Airport_scannerII.c", line 10224: warning: variable "entry_exit" was declared but never referenced int intersect=0,entry_exit=0; ^ "./Airport_scannerII.c", line 10225: warning: variable "lmin" was declared but never referenced double lmin; ^ "./Airport_scannerII.c", line 10226: warning: variable "idx" was declared but never referenced int idx; ^ "./Airport_scannerII.c", line 11584: warning: variable "t" is used before its value is set mcstartdate = (long)t; /* set start date before parsing options and creating sim file */ ^ "./Airport_scannerII.c", line 11524: warning: variable "ct" was declared but never referenced clock_t ct; ^ "./Airport_scannerII.c", line 1245: warning: variable "mcstartdate" was set but never used static long mcstartdate = 0; /* start simulation time */ ^ "./Airport_scannerII.c", line 2486: warning: function "strcpy_valid" was declared but never referenced static char *strcpy_valid(char *valid, char *original) ^ mcgenstate: 81, Generating acc routine seq Generating Tesla code particle_getvar: 95, Generating acc routine seq Generating Tesla code particle_restore: 120, Generating acc routine seq Generating Tesla code particle_getuservar_byid: 128, Generating acc routine seq Generating Tesla code particle_uservar_init: 138, Generating acc routine seq Generating Tesla code noprintf: 1277, Generating acc routine seq Generating Tesla code str_comp: 1281, Generating acc routine seq Generating Tesla code str_len: 1290, Generating acc routine seq Generating Tesla code mcget_ncount: 3464, Generating acc routine seq Generating Tesla code coords_set: 3701, Generating acc routine seq Generating Tesla code coords_get: 3712, Generating acc routine seq Generating Tesla code coords_add: 3721, Generating acc routine seq Generating Tesla code coords_sub: 3733, Generating acc routine seq Generating Tesla code coords_neg: 3745, Generating acc routine seq Generating Tesla code coords_scale: 3755, Generating acc routine seq Generating Tesla code coords_sp: 3765, Generating acc routine seq Generating Tesla code coords_xp: 3773, Generating acc routine seq Generating Tesla code coords_len: 3783, Generating acc routine seq Generating Tesla code coords_print: 3805, Generating acc routine seq Generating Tesla code coords_norm: 3812, Generating acc routine seq Generating Tesla code rot_set_rotation: 3858, Generating acc routine seq Generating Tesla code rot_test_identity: 3893, Generating acc routine seq Generating Tesla code rot_mul: 3904, Generating acc routine seq Generating Tesla code rot_copy: 3921, Generating acc routine seq Generating Tesla code rot_transpose: 3932, Generating acc routine seq Generating Tesla code rot_apply: 3948, Generating acc routine seq Generating Tesla code vec_prod_func: 3977, Generating acc routine seq Generating Tesla code scalar_prod: 3988, Generating acc routine seq Generating Tesla code norm_func: 3992, Generating acc routine seq Generating Tesla code sort_absorb_last: 4027, Generating present(particles[:1],pbuffer[:1]) Generating Tesla code 4034,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 4043, #pragma acc loop seq 4027, Generating implicit copy(lens[:]) [if not already present] 4045, Accelerator restriction: induction variable live-out from loop: i 4046, Accelerator restriction: induction variable live-out from loop: i 4047, Accelerator restriction: induction variable live-out from loop: i 4048, Accelerator restriction: induction variable live-out from loop: i 4050, Accelerator restriction: induction variable live-out from loop: j 4051, Accelerator restriction: induction variable live-out from loop: j 4052, Accelerator restriction: induction variable live-out from loop: j 4053, Accelerator restriction: induction variable live-out from loop: j 4075, Generating present(pbuffer[:1]) Generating Tesla code 4079,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 4082, #pragma acc loop seq 4075, Generating implicit copyin(lens[:],los[:]) [if not already present] Generating implicit copy(particles[:]) [if not already present] 4099, Generating present(particles[:1]) Generating Tesla code 4103,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 4110, #pragma acc loop seq 4099, Local memory used for targetbuffer,sourcebuffer mccoordschange: 4169, Generating acc routine seq Generating Tesla code mccoordschange_polarisation: 4200, Generating acc routine seq Generating Tesla code normal_vec: 4217, Generating acc routine seq Generating Tesla code solve_2nd_order: 4316, Generating acc routine seq Generating Tesla code _randvec_target_circle: 4400, Generating acc routine seq Generating Tesla code _randvec_target_rect_angular: 4466, Generating acc routine seq Generating Tesla code _randvec_target_rect_real: 4543, Generating acc routine seq Generating Tesla code kiss_srandom: 4815, Generating acc routine seq Generating Tesla code kiss_random: 4825, Generating acc routine seq Generating Tesla code _hash: 4851, Generating acc routine seq Generating Tesla code _randnorm2: 4892, Generating acc routine seq Generating Tesla code _randtriangle: 4903, Generating acc routine seq Generating Tesla code _rand01: 4908, Generating acc routine seq Generating Tesla code _randpm1: 4916, Generating acc routine seq Generating Tesla code _rand0max: 4924, Generating acc routine seq Generating Tesla code _randminmax: 4931, Generating acc routine seq Generating Tesla code mcsetstate: 5526, Generating acc routine seq Generating Tesla code mcgetstate: 5559, Generating acc routine seq Generating Tesla code inside_rectangle: 5620, Generating acc routine seq Generating Tesla code box_intersect: 5636, Generating acc routine seq Generating Tesla code cylinder_intersect: 5722, Generating acc routine seq Generating Tesla code sphere_intersect: 5790, Generating acc routine seq Generating Tesla code Table_Index: 6873, Generating acc routine seq Generating Tesla code Table_Value: 6941, Generating acc routine seq Generating Tesla code Table_Value2d: 7020, Generating acc routine seq Generating Tesla code Table_Interp1d: 7458, Generating acc routine seq Generating Tesla code Table_Interp1d_nearest: 7474, Generating acc routine seq Generating Tesla code Table_Interp2d: 7492, Generating acc routine seq Generating Tesla code off_F: 7717, Generating acc routine seq Generating Tesla code off_sign: 7722, Generating acc routine seq Generating Tesla code off_normal: 7732, Generating acc routine seq Generating Tesla code off_pnpoly: 7758, Generating acc routine seq Generating Tesla code off_intersectPoly: 7820, Generating acc routine seq Generating Tesla code off_init_planes: 7951, Generating acc routine seq Generating Tesla code off_clip_3D_mod: 7996, Generating acc routine seq Generating Tesla code off_compare: 8108, Generating acc routine seq Generating Tesla code off_cleanDouble: 8120, Generating acc routine seq Generating Tesla code off_cleanInOut: 8155, Generating acc routine seq Generating Tesla code Min_int: 8399, Generating acc routine seq Generating Tesla code off_intersect_all: 8515, Generating acc routine seq Generating Tesla code off_intersect: 8597, Generating acc routine seq Generating Tesla code off_x_intersect: 8619, Generating acc routine seq Generating Tesla code abs_object_refract: 8699, Generating acc routine seq Generating Tesla code init: 9790, Generating update device(_source1_var,_sample_scan_var,_instrument_var,_Origin_var,_psd_far_var,_sample_mount_point_var,_psd0_var,_psd2_var,_emon_var) class_Progress_bar_trace: 9831, Generating acc routine seq Generating Tesla code class_Source_flat_trace: 9909, Generating acc routine seq Generating Tesla code class_PSD_monitor_trace: 10041, Generating acc routine seq Generating Tesla code class_E_monitor_trace: 10127, Generating acc routine seq Generating Tesla code class_Abs_objects_trace: 10197, Generating acc routine seq Generating Tesla code 10249, Reference argument passing prevents parallelization: l1 Reference argument passing prevents parallelization: l0 10318, Reference argument passing prevents parallelization: l1 Reference argument passing prevents parallelization: l0 raytrace_all_funnel: 10648, Generating present(particles[:1]) Generating Tesla code 10652,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 10659, Generating present(particles[:1]) Generating Tesla code 10664,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 10659, Local memory used for _particle_save Generating implicit copy(.I0366,.I0363,.I0359,.I0349,.I0345,.I0335,.I0331,.I0321,.I0317,.I0314,.I0324,.I0328,.I0338,.I0342,.I0352,.I0356) [if not already present] 10769, Generating present(particles[:1]) Generating Tesla code 10773, #pragma acc loop gang, vector(128) /* blockIdx.x threadIdx.x */ finally: 11184, Generating update self(_source1_var,_sample_scan_var,_instrument_var,_Origin_var,_psd_far_var,_sample_mount_point_var,_psd0_var,_psd2_var,_emon_var) WARNING: Ignoring invalid parameter: "Airport_scannerII.instr" INFO: === [Airp_scannerII] Initialize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/book.txt' (Table_Read_Offset) Loading geometry file (OFF/PLY): book.ply Number of vertices: 2853 Number of polygons: 5722 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ry book.ply will be applied! Bounding box dimensions for geometry book.ply: Length=0.239599 (100.000%) Width= 0.029804 (100.000%) Depth= 0.164529 (100.000%) sample_scan: Volume[1], material='book.txt' geometry='book.ply'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/h2o2.dat' (Table_Read_Offset) Loading geometry file (OFF/PLY): h2o2.ply Number of vertices: 406 Number of polygons: 808 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ry h2o2.ply will be applied! Bounding box dimensions for geometry h2o2.ply: Length=0.126295 (100.000%) Width= 0.046911 (100.000%) Depth= 0.090087 (100.000%) sample_scan: Volume[2], material='h2o2.dat' geometry='h2o2.ply'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/H2O.txt' (Table_Read_Offset) Loading geometry file (OFF/PLY): water.ply Number of vertices: 818 Number of polygons: 1632 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ry water.ply will be applied! Bounding box dimensions for geometry water.ply: Length=0.066238 (100.000%) Width= 0.058313 (100.000%) Depth= 0.217547 (100.000%) sample_scan: Volume[3], material='H2O.txt' geometry='water.ply'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/ethanol.txt' (Table_Read_Offset) Loading geometry file (OFF/PLY): whiskey.ply Number of vertices: 616 Number of polygons: 1228 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ry whiskey.ply will be applied! Bounding box dimensions for geometry whiskey.ply: Length=0.082601 (100.000%) Width= 0.076881 (100.000%) Depth= 0.141927 (100.000%) sample_scan: Volume[4], material='ethanol.txt' geometry='whiskey.ply'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/Cu.txt' (Table_Read_Offset) Loading geometry file (OFF/PLY): wire.ply Number of vertices: 2584 Number of polygons: 5438 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ry wire.ply will be applied! Bounding box dimensions for geometry wire.ply: Length=0.173456 (100.000%) Width= 0.078031 (100.000%) Depth= 0.145752 (100.000%) sample_scan: Volume[5], material='Cu.txt' geometry='wire.ply' Opening input file '/zhome/89/0/38697/McXtrace/mcxtrace/3.x-dev/tools/Python/mxrun/../mccodelib/../../../data/Al.txt' (Table_Read_Offset) Loading geometry file (OFF/PLY): luggage.off Number of vertices: 37707 Number of polygons: 84521 Warning: Neither xwidth, yheight or zdepth are defined. The file-defined (non-scaled) geometry the OFF geometry luggage.off will be applied! Bounding box dimensions for geometry luggage.off: Length=0.324186 (100.000%) Width= 0.260044 (100.000%) Depth= 0.540097 (100.000%) sample_scan: Volume[6], material='Al.txt' geometry='luggage.off' NOTE: CPU COMPONENT grammar activated: 1) "FUNNEL" raytrace algorithm enabled. 2) Any SPLIT's are dynamically allocated based on available buffer size. Save [Airp_scannerII] Detector: psd0_I=0.00103487 psd0_ERR=1.46354e-07 psd0_N=5e+07 "psd0.dat" Detector: emon_I=0.00103487 emon_ERR=1.46354e-07 emon_N=5e+07 "emon.dat" Detector: psd2_I=0.000643394 psd2_ERR=1.13553e-07 psd2_N=3.8271e+07 "psd2.dat" Detector: psd_far_I=1.17459e-05 psd_far_ERR=1.4423e-08 psd_far_N=1.53109e+06 "psdfar.dat" Finally [Airp_scannerII: 1]. Time: 8.28333 [min] INFO: Placing instr file copy /zhome/89/0/38697/xTESTS/2022-04-01/McXtrace_GPU_PGCC_TESLA_KISS_FUNNEL_5e7/Airport_scannerII/Airport_scannerII.instr in dataset 1 loading system configuration loading override configuration from /zhome/89/0/38697/mxtest/mctest/../mccodelib/mcxtrace-test/McXtrace_GPU_PGCC_TESLA_KISS_FUNNEL/mccode_config.json